Diet Control Over Gym Workouts: NTR and Suriya's Fitness Philosophy Goes Viral

The fitness world is buzzing after Kollywood star Suriya echoed Young Tiger NTR's long-standing philosophy that diet control trumps intensive gym workouts. Both stars have become poster boys for dramatic physical transformations, and their approach is reshaping how we think about celebrity fitness.

NTR's transformation from his heavier days to his current lean physique has been the talk of the industry for years. The actor has consistently maintained that strict diet control, not grueling gym sessions, was the secret behind his remarkable change. His philosophy is simple yet effective: control what goes into your mouth, and the body will naturally follow.

Suriya's recent comments have given fresh momentum to this school of thought. The Tamil star candidly admitted that this truth only dawned on him after turning 25. "Bodies are made in the kitchen, not in the gym," Suriya declared, sparking intense debate among fitness enthusiasts across South India.

The actor revealed that lifting weights or running on treadmills didn't yield the results he expected. Instead, disciplined eating patterns and avoiding processed, high-calorie foods became his game-changers. This mirrors what fitness experts have been saying: that fitness is 70% diet and 30% exercise.

What's particularly striking is how both stars emphasize the unglamorous side of their transformations. Behind the red-carpet looks and chiseled physiques lie rigid food restrictions, timely meals, and complete elimination of sugar and junk food. It's a reality check for fans who assume celebrity fitness is just about having access to expensive trainers and equipment.

This philosophy challenges the conventional gym-centric approach that dominates fitness culture today. While the fitness industry continues to push intensive workout regimens, these leading men are advocating for sustainable, traditional eating habits focused on nutritional value rather than convenience.

Their message is clear: glamorous lifestyles require unglamorous sacrifices, and the real battle for fitness is won at the dining table, not the dumbbell rack.
